Guangzhou (Canton), a prosperous metropolis full of vigor, is the capital city of Guangdong Province located along the south coastline of China. Being an excellent port on the Pearl River navigable to the South China Sea, and with fast accessibility to Hong Kong and Macau, Guangzhou serves as the political, economic, scientific, educational and cultural center in Guangdong area.
Being the first cities benefited from China's Reform and Opening Up policy since 1978, Guangzhou acts as the pioneer of the economic development of the country, with thousands of large, small and medium-sized enterprises, which offer more job opportunities and make the city a heavily populated area. The city is especially prosperous in commerce, tourism, dining, finance and real estate. For travelers, Guangzhou shows much attraction through its famous sights such as the Five Ram Statue in Yuexiu Park, Pearl River and White Cloud Mountain.

Walking in Guangzhou China on Beijing Road Shopping District
The entire street stretches from the Zhongshan Wu Lu to Huifu Lu. The total stretch covers an approximate distance of 440 meters with around 138 stores on both sides of the street. The stores sell everything from clothes and shoes to accessories, general merchandise, jewelry and even food. Beware of pickpockets, and hassled by people trying to sell t shirts, watches etc etc what I did is offer them 10RMB (£1) for anything they try to sell me which made them go away.

Beijing Lu road Guangzhou walking and shopping street
This Beijing Lu walking street 北京路 is the main pedestrian shopping street of Guangzhou city. actually it built on top of the ancient street and u can look through glass plate to see the excavation site and surface of older road deep down.

GUANGZHOU - Beijing Road to Haizhu Square
GUANGZHOU
Beijing Road to Haizhu Square
The Beijing Road (Beijing Lu) Pedestrian Street is one of the oldest roads in Guangzhou, known for its shopping district and its numerous historic sights.
Haizhu Square, in Yuexiu District, has at its center the Guangzhou Liberation Statue, erected in 1959.
